Icons!


Like I had written on my website, these represent just a few of the icons I get done in a day ( an eight hour day) Normally, I'll get from seven to eight done and have maybe, a few different versions of one for them to pick from just in case they didn' like the one I supplied. I like to leave them with plenty of options. Sometimes, I'm able to scan them in if I have the wherewithall to do so. A lot of times, the search for decent reference to draw from takes a lot of time. Modified Capital Building


Modified Capital Building, originally uploaded by jodydraws.

This editorial was a lot of work. The general idea was to have vignettes that were visible enough to be seen in the windows of the capital building. In order to do that we had to modify the windows greatly. I think it took me the whole day to complete this. The vignettes were Merger's and Acquisitions, CEO payoffs, Partnership, etc..
I have to take them from the original file in order to post them but I was happy with the way they turned out. Instead of being simple silhouettes, I would draw them out and then shade them a bit so that you could sort of see the detail. It's more time consuming than you'd think.
